How much do summer react developer j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 28, 2026, the average yearly pay for summer react developer in Virginia is $128,239.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$105,100.00 and $155,700.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What types of projects and responsibilities can I expect as a Summer React Developer?

As a Summer React Developer, you can expect to work on real-world web applications, which may involve building new features, fixing bugs, and improving user interfaces using React.js. Day-to-day tasks often include collaborating with senior developers, participating in code reviews, writing unit tests, and integrating APIs. You'll likely work as part of an agile development team, gaining hands-on experience with modern workflows and best practices. This role provides a great learning environment and the chance to make meaningful contributions, setting a strong foundation for a future career in front-end development.

What is a Summer React Developer job?

A Summer React Developer job is a seasonal position where developers use React.js to build and enhance web applications. These roles are typically offered as internships or short-term contracts by companies looking to develop or maintain front-end projects. Responsibilities often include writing and testing React components, integrating APIs, and collaborating with other developers and designers. This job provides hands-on experience with modern web development, making it ideal for students or early-career developers looking to gain industry experience.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Summer React Developer position, and why are they important?

To excel as a Summer React Developer, you need strong skills in JavaScript, React.js, HTML, and CSS, often supported by coursework or hands-on experience in web development. Familiarity with tools like Git, npm, modern IDEs, and possibly exposure to frameworks such as Redux or TypeScript is valuable. Strong problem-solving abilities, attention to detail, teamwork, and effective communication are important soft skills in this role. These competencies ensure you can quickly learn, contribute to team projects, and deliver user-friendly web applications within a limited time frame.
